There are restaurants that look great and some are even unforgettably beautiful; but after all is said and done, the design or the atmosphere or the natural setting it was located in is all you remember. That’s not the case at all with Avista in Funchal, the capital of beautiful Madeira, which boasts not just one of the most beautiful restaurant locations one could wish for but also serves spectacular food coupled with an outstanding wine list. The place is simply everything you’d want a restaurant to be, beginning with absolutely magical terrace where you can gaze at the ocean opening up in front of you as well as from the main dining room inside which features floor to ceiling windows that are spotlessly clean. The design of the restaurant is also noteworthy, with well-distanced tables that are nicely appointed and comfortable.
